python列表操作

count():

    统计列表中元素重复的次数

name = ["1", "2", "2", "1"]
print(name.count("1"))

len():

    就算“长度”

    如果要统计列表中所有的元素的个数那么用count()函数就不行了,因为count()至少要输入一个参数,此时就可以用到len()函数了,

name = ["1", "2", "2", "1"]
print(len(name))

列表的切片:

    直接用列表名+[ ](里面的第一个参数表示起始位置,第二个参数是步长,默认是1,可以省略,第三个参数是停止位置,应该是停止位置的前一个,是不包括前一个位置的)

append():

    在列表中的最后位置添加元素

name = ["4", "3", "2", "1"]
name.append("5")
print(name)
name = ["4", "3", "2", "1"]
name.reverse()
print(name)

 

insert():

    可以在任意位置插入新元素

name = ["4", "3", "2", "1"]
name.insert(1,"zhanghuarong")
print(name)

替换:

name = ["4", "3", "2", "1"]
name[2] = "liming"
print(name)

remove():

name = ["4", "3", "2", "1"]
name.remove("3")
print(name)

reverse():

列表元素翻转

name = ["4", "3", "2", "1"]
name.reverse()
print(name)

sort():

升序排序

name = ["4", "3", "1", "2"]
name.sort()
print(name)

extend():

name = ["4", "3", "1", "2"]
name2 = [1, 2, 3, 4]
name.extend(name2)
print(name)

clear():

清除列表所有的元素

name = ["4", "3", "1", "2"]
name.clear()
print(name)

清除列表元素以后就是一个空列表了。

 

posted @ 2018-03-31 12:23  高山寨顶  阅读(171)  评论(0)    收藏  举报